In Italy, Foreign Minister Mondino opened an event on investment opportunities in the Argentine energy sector

Tuesday, 25 June 2024

On the second and last day of her official visit to Italy, Foreign Minister Mondino, together with her Italian counterpart, Antonio Tajani, opened the event "Argentina: new opportunities in the energy sector and in productive transition." The meeting, held at Palacio Francesco Turati, headquarters of the Milan Chamber of Commerce and Industry, was attended by over 190 businesspeople and local investors.

It was organized by the Italian Chamber of Commerce in Argentina and Promos Italia—an agency that promotes the internationalization of Italian companies—together with the Italian Foreign Ministry and the Italian Trade Agency. On behalf of Argentina, the meeting was attended by the Governor of the Province of Chubut, Ignacio Torres; the president of ENARSA, Juan Carlos Doncel Jones; the president of the Chamber of Hydrocarbon Producers, Carlos Ormachea; and executives of energy companies, among others.

The Argentine Foreign Minister offered an overview of the structural economic, institutional and social reforms implemented in Argentina and said that the development of the energy sector and the increase of Argentina's energy potential are part of the policies introduced by President Milei's Administration. She added that boosting businesses will contribute to the prompt development of the sector, provided there is an environment conducive to investments and a closer connection between businesspeople from both countries. Special emphasis was placed on the development of value chains with Argentine and Italian SMEs.

The Foreign Minister stated that "Argentina needs productive and infrastructure investments to realize its potential as a reliable player in the global energy market. Since December 2023, the purpose of this new administration has been to free the market forces and promote private enterprises and foreign direct investment." Then, she stressed that "we are promoting a stable macroeconomic framework, with legal certainty and transparent and foresseable rules, in order to create a favourable environment for the private sector and investments in Argentina"

In addition, she reiterated that "Argentina's OECD accession process, aimed at strengthening the country's insertion into the global scenario, is of major importance." Regarding the negotiations for the MERCOSUR-EU Agreement, she reaffirmed that "concluding the agreement is one of the priorities of the Argentine Government" and added that Argentina hopes that both blocs can work together to overcome pending challenges and conclude the agreement promptly. "The Argentine working teams are ready to get to work immediately," she said.

The president of ENARSA, Juan Carlos Doncel Jones, explained the scope and advantages of the Regime of Incentives for Large Investments (RIGI). In addition, he stated that it is estimated that Argentina's energy exports may grow from USD 9.297 billion in 2022 to USD 26.610 billion in 2030, due to the oil and gas boom in Vaca Muerta and the development of liquefied natural gas (LNG) and green hydrogen.

Foreign Minister Tajani, who participated virtually, highlighted the current state of the bilateral relationship, as well as Argentina's importance as partner in the region. He also invited Foreign Minister Mondino to the upcoming G7 Ministerial Meeting on Trade, which will take place on 16 and 17 June in Calabria.

After the event, Foreign Minister Mondino met with Enrico Laghi, CEO of Edizione Holding SpA and Benetton—both of which have significant presence in Argentina, particularly in the infrastructure sector—, who expressed the group's interest in investing in various energy undertakings.
